Speaking of No Tach... my cars a CX (the guy i bought it of of said it is) but i think its a DX (the cars canadian so thats why the CX, its the Std up here) but ne ways... my car doesnt have a tach either, is it possible 2 buy an aftermarket tach like one of the 5 1/2" ones with a shift light and still be able to hook it upto my car? and if my cars either the CX (std model) or DX would that explain not having a stock tach?

slammed89civic
01-05-2003, 06:25 PM
yes, you can install an aftermarket tach, but i would honestly have a Si cluster with the tach built in then have the five 1/2 inch spaceship tachometer, im my opinion (im not flaming anyone, this is just my opinion)the 5 1/2 tach makes the clean lines on the dash look hella cluttered and just bad. but if you decide to take the aftermarket route take out your cluster and find the wire on the bigger harness that is solid blue, no stripe, just blue, and that is the tach signal wire

91civicDXdude
01-05-2003, 11:36 PM
the dx and si have the same bumpers, only the Si adds a small rubber lip on the bottom. the Si also adds body colored mirrors (passenger mirror included), body colored door handles, different interior, clock, tach, sunroof, different engine, and different wheels..14's
